General Service 1918-62, 1 clasp, Malaya, G.VI.R. (Capt. F. J. Johnston, Coldm. Gds.) official correction to unit, otherwise extremely fine £160-200

Francis James Johnston was born in Birkenhead on 26 August 1928. He was educated at Birkenhead Prep. School; Old Hall School, Wellington, Shropshire, Rugby School and the Royal Military Academy. He was granted a regular commission in the Coldstream Guards on 22 December 1948 and was posted to the 3rd Battalion, serving in Malaya, August 1949-Setember 1950. He was promoted Lieutenant in December 1950 and Temporary Captain in November 1952. Posted to the 2nd Battalion he served with the B.A.O.R., November 1952-July 1955, being promoted to Captain in December 1954. Further service at Home followed, being advanced to Temporary Major in March 1958. He retired to the R.A.R.O. with the rank of Major in 1 October 1959. Sold with a quantity of copied service papers and other research. Medal in card box of issue.
